WebThe ground had three cricket… Show more During my employment at Merchant Taylors’ I was asked to manage the OMT (Old Merchant Taylors’) a 20 acre satellite sportsfield for a … On 9 August 1947, during a game of cricket against the Cheetham 2nd XI at Cheetham Cricket Ground in Manchester, a batsman from the visiting team hit the ball for six. The ball flew out of the ground, hitting the claimant, Miss Stone, who was standing outside her house in Cheetham Hill Road, approximately 100 yards (91 m) from the batsman. The club had been playing cricket at the ground since 1864, before the road was built in 1910. Th… WebStone lived in a house adjacent to the Cheetham Cricket Ground. On 9 August 1947, a batsman playing in a match at the Cricket Ground hit the ball out of the ground. The ball hit Stone while she was standing outside her house. WebNov 28, 2024 · This lady was struck on the head by a ball hit out of the Cheetham Cricket Ground and she sued the club. At Manchester Assizes in 1948 Mr. Justice Oliver found in favour of the club but Miss Stone appealed against this decision and had the verdict reversed, being awarded damages of £104 19s 6d. and costs amounting to £449. ... WebCricket had been played on the Cheetham Cricket Ground, which was surrounded by a net, since the late 1800s. In 1947, a batsman hit the ball over the fence, hitting Miss Stone and injuring her. In the history of the club, a ball had only been hit over the fence about 6 times before, and had never hit anybody.
